Employers in new york are required by law to provide state disability insurance (sdi) coverage for eligible employees. Employers can choose to cover the entire cost, or to withhold an allowed portion of employees' wages towards the cost. Like hawaii, new york gives employers an option to pay their workers’ share of state disability as a benefit of the job. All plans must be accepted by the board and will need to adhere to the statutory requirements of the new york state disability and paid family leave law (wcl section 211).
